Capacity note for support: the Klaxon deduplicator collapses repeated on-call alerts within a sliding window before paging anyone. At current Norwick-region volumes we're near the window's memory ceiling; expect occasional duplicate pages during storms until we resize. If customers report double pages, check the dedup hit rate first rather than the paging provider. The window and cache sizes now in effect are shown below.

tuning constants:
WEIGHTS = {
    "wendor": 631,
    "norir": 625,
    "julael": 998,
}

- [ ] **Step 7: Breaker override escrow.** After sealing the signing keys for the Tallgrove upstream API circuit breaker, confirm the support team can force the breaker open during a full outage. The override bundle lives in the sealed escrow drawer and is useless without its unlock phrase. Two ceremony witnesses must initial this step before proceeding. The escrow bundle is decrypted with the recovery passphrase that follows.

vault phrase of kahip-kahop = holath-quenmir

**Mgmt Meeting Minutes — Retiring the Brightline Range**

Quick recap for sales leads at Fenholt Supplies: we agreed to retire the Brightline fixture range by year-end. Remaining stock moves to clearance pricing next month, and accounts on standing orders get migrated to the Lumetta range. Trade-in incentives were approved in principle. The confidential note on next steps sits just below.

board note of bajof-bajeg: The pricing group signed off on a budget of $13.4 million for Project Sildor. The renewal with Lamixek Holdings closes at $48.9 million a year, 49 percent above the last contract.

Subject: On-call handover — orders soft deletes

Hi Marek,

Quick note before you take over. We shipped the soft-delete change to the Cartwheel orders table last night: rows now get a deleted_at timestamp instead of being removed. Plugin authors querying orders directly must filter on deleted_at IS NULL, or they'll see ghost orders. The compat view orders_active handles this automatically. Docs are updated in the Cartwheel developer portal. If plugin authors hit anything weird, route them to the integrations inbox.

escalation mailbox, tafop-fahif: oliael@tolvaqlabs.corp